Product description for Hoya STAR-EIGHT, IN SQ.CASE 58 mm

Star filters create dramatic multi-point light reflections or beams of light, also known as the "star effect", that highlight bright or strong point light sources. HOYA star filters have structures etched into the surface of the filter's high quality optical glass to create the star effect.

Each of the filters, STAR 4X, STAR 6X and STAR 8X, has different line patterns etched into the glass to create the number of light rays for the filter. The star filter creates a beautiful and romantic effect by emitting multiple rays of light emanating from a point light source or bright object in the image. The appearance of the beam may vary depending on the aperture setting, size, strength of the light source and distance from the camera.

Find the best angle of the star effect according to your personal preference by rotating the filter frame. When recording a video, rotate the frame to achieve dynamic and rhythmic movements of the rays.

STAR 8
Artistic filter to create a beautiful 8-beam cross flare effect. The HOYA STAR 8X filter creates an 8-beam flare on light sources and is suitable for shooting night lighting, reflections on water surfaces, light falling through leaves, photographs of jewelry and other scenes with tiny light sources.
